Qameron, Of this• +village " .Another pleasant event which the •Eaglc takes. e u as re in sono u ne .ln 1S. ,p _ g marriage. of• Mr, 'Alexander M. Cameron, `'of Cooperstown, pak,',.^.and Miss° Mary Cuthbertson; ,of Ripon, • Dak. The marriage took place on :iTednesday,. Pec.''21st.,,iri Wheatland,, at: the Fres- byterian pagsonage; Rees J. McKee officiating.; Mr, Cameron ` is a; venni .marl of ,pleasing, address, is well liked here. Abouts, and is a good, hsrnest farmer by occupation. Mrs. Cameron, itee'Cuth. bertson, is the. daughter of hn.- Cuthbertson, a wealthy and industrious` farmer, residing nearItipon. • ' While the' Raate--is:: always. -`-ready and pleased • to ,make note of these' events, we,.feel that it is, MA" Just the proper caer for' a young man who lives'away up in 'Griggs county to gone fooling round these,. parts 'and. take frons, our. -midst one of Or brightest and most brilliant young! ladies. : Yet : we. must -succumb • tai -.the inevitable, and while we realizethat,with each gonef,'o f these events -our' chances are: lessened, we cannot blit in justice to both these.•happy:people wish ,thein un- bounded success and. happiness;: They retinaiined at Ripon. for about a, week, wheiia, they •. •removed to the 'groom's fares near Cooperstown." tr re BELT ST • ,, ITEMS.
